What are Reusable K-Cups?
Reusable K-Cups are stainless steel or plastic cups that are designed to be filled with your own coffee grounds and used in single-serve coffee makers. They’re a great alternative to traditional K-Cups, as they can be used multiple times, reducing the amount of waste generated by disposable cups. Reusable K-Cups are also a cost-effective option, as you can buy your favorite coffee beans in bulk and fill your own cups.

Coffee Grind Size
The grind size of your coffee is important when using reusable K-Cups. If the grind is too fine, it can clog the cup and prevent the water from flowing through. On the other hand, if the grind is too coarse, it can result in a weak or under-extracted cup. A medium-coarse grind is usually best, as it allows for the right amount of water to flow through the coffee.
| Coffee Grind Size | Description |
|---|---|
| Extra Fine | Similar to powdered sugar, extra fine grind is too fine for reusable K-Cups. |
| Fine | Similar to granulated sugar, fine grind is still too fine for reusable K-Cups. |
| Medium | Similar to kosher salt, medium grind is a good starting point for reusable K-Cups. |
| Medium-Coarse | Similar to sea salt, medium-coarse grind is the best grind size for reusable K-Cups. |
| Coarse | Similar to peppercorns, coarse grind is too coarse for reusable K-Cups. |
How to Use Regular Coffee in Reusable K-Cups
Using regular coffee in reusable K-Cups is easy. Here’s a step-by-step guide:
Step 1: Choose Your Coffee
Choose a freshly roasted coffee with a medium to medium-dark roast level. You can use any type of coffee you like, including Arabica or Robusta.
Step 2: Grind Your Coffee
Grind your coffee to a medium-coarse grind. You can use a burr grinder or a rolling grinder to grind your coffee.
Step 3: Fill Your Reusable K-Cup
Fill your reusable K-Cup with the ground coffee. Make sure to fill the cup to the recommended level, usually about 2-3 tablespoons.
Step 4: Place the Reusable K-Cup in Your Coffee Maker
Place the reusable K-Cup in your coffee maker, making sure it’s securely locked in place.
Step 5: Brew Your Coffee
Brew your coffee as you normally would. The water will flow through the coffee grounds, and you’ll be left with a delicious cup of coffee.

How do I clean and maintain my reusable K-cup?
Cleaning and maintaining your reusable K-cup is essential to ensure optimal performance and flavor. After each use, simply rinse the reusable K-cup with warm water to remove any coffee grounds and residue. For more thorough cleaning, mix equal parts water and white vinegar in the reusable K-cup and let it sit for a few minutes. Then, rinse the reusable K-cup with warm water and dry it thoroughly.
Regularly cleaning and maintaining your reusable K-cup will prevent any buildup of old coffee oils and residue, which can affect the flavor of your coffee. It’s also essential to descale your coffee maker regularly to prevent mineral buildup, which can affect the performance of the machine and the flavor of your coffee.
